How Often Do You Need to Service Your Car?

If you are a conscientious driver, you won’t take good care of your vehicle.  But you may be wondering just how often do you need to service your car?  The answer is actually quite simple. Follow the factory-recommended service schedule that is listed in your owner’s manual.  This will help ensure that you are driving as safe as possible, especially if you are planning to head out for a summer road trip.

With the advancements in technology, many newer cars have a maintenance reminder system built-in that makes mileage-based schedules obsolete. This reminder system is programmed to take a number of car driving conditions into account and provides an alert on the instrument panel when it is time for certain services, such as oil changes, fluid level inspects, component checkups, and other car services.  Even though you should be able to trust this reminder system, it’s still a good idea to double-check with your car repair mechanic about any recommended services, especially if you don’t drive put many miles during a year’s time.

Older vehicles have service intervals based on the number of miles driven within a certain time period. There are generally two different maintenance schedules listed in your owner’s manual—one for cars driven in “normal” conditions and another for those driven in “severe” operating conditions. The exact definition of “severe” varies, but it will usually include one or more of the following conditions:
  • Primarily short trips (5 miles or less) 
  • Sustained stop-and-go driving
  • Extremely hot, cold, or dusty climates
  • Mountainous terrain
  • Carrying heavy loads or towing a trailer.
